REPAIR SERVICES

We do all manner of electric and acoustic repair and restoration of guitars, basses, mandolins, ukuleles, and just about any fretted instrument (and fretless basses!) I can't possibly list all the repairs we perform, but here are a few sample prices of common repairs. Call about anything you don't see here.

Setup - $70
Setup for locking tremolo - $85
Hand cut and polished nut or saddle - $60
Hand cut and polished nut for 12 string - $75
Hand cut, polished, and compensated saddle for 12-string - $150
Fret level and dress (includes set-up) - $140
Refret - $340 add $60 for binding or finished maple
Pickup replacement - (1) $30 (2) $50 (3) $70
(add $10 per pickup for semi or hollow body guitars)
Shield guitar - From $75
Replace switch or pot (plus parts cost) - $30
Coil tap or Series/Parallel push pot (includes parts) - $45
Coil tap or series/split/parallel switch (includes parts) - $40
4-way switch for Tele (includes parts) - $50
Route pickup cavity - From $50
Add 22nd fret to Strat or Tele neck - $200-$250
Floyd Rose installation - $260
Buzz Feiten Tuning System for electric guitar - $150
Buzz Feiten Tuning System for acoustic guitar - $400
Evertune installation - "S" style $275, "T" style $225, "G" style $325
Acoustic guitar pickup installation (under saddle) includes setup - $100
Acoustic guitar bridge reset - $85
Acoustic guitar bridge replacement - $185
Acoustic guitar cracks per inch - $15
Acoustic guitar cracks requiring splice per inch - $25
Cleat crack per cleat - $30
Headstock repair from - $85
Headstock repair with cosmetics from - $185
Neck Reset - Martin style from - $300
Neck Reset - Gibson style from - $450
Fix loose brace from - $25
Heat treat neck - $100+
Restorations - Ask
Custom assembled guitars - From $1800
Anything else! - Ask
